I am new to the GS line, but have driven a couple Lexus vehicles over the years. Like any Toyota / Lexus product, the timing belt is very important. The GS appears to have issues with the door lock actuators (see top of main forum page for details). Otherwise just do the standard maintenance and oil change and you should be good to go. Welcome!
